Transaction 3d83ceca4c2afa23a6ee73764a1689834b4b17b398acfe3131373010817be1a2
1 Input
1 Output
-
3d83ceca4c2afa23a6ee73764a1689834b4b17b398acfe3131373010817be1a2:0
- value
- 507525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 725843ce079c96b5cb41656cf4b2d2bac266b569 OP_EQUAL
- address
- 3C7chAPBeH3N8nMffFuoDZ7znPuQJ81N6z